It's not that the complaints might or might not be valid that's so annoying - it's the way that they are pursued. For example, a plane buzzed a house in our estate a few days ago, wing-waggling and doing steep turns over (presumably) the new SPL's house. Low enough that he was below the 1500' AGL limit for built-up areas (irish regs) and low enough for me to not only read the reg but see the pilot's head distinctly. Now I personally enjoyed it and have no intention of submitting a complaint, past the "lucky sod, wish I was doing that" one, but if I did, it wouldn't be a complaint but a quiet word in the ear of the CFI - not a formal complaint to the local authorities. That is something you only do for a serious chronic problem. Otherwise you're talking about trying to get an airfield shut down to stop one pilot from buzzing your house - and to succeed there, you'd have to shut down each and every airfield in the country, and all private strips, and all big grass fields! A quiet word to the CFI from someone who has a valid worry leads to a slightly louder word in the ear of the relevant pilot (or instructor) and that is far more effective IMO. And if the worry is ill-informed and invalid, well, who better than the CFI to dispell worry and extend an invitation to visit the airfield and maybe learn to fly themselves?
